Detectives have arrested four men after Emmerdale actress Chelsea Halfpenny made an emotional plea to find those responsible for her granddad's hit and run accident. On Monday, the soap star emotionally urged any witnesses to come forward after her grandad was struck by a car in Gateshead, Tyne and Wear at the age of 85 on Friday evening, February 25. Following the accident, Northumbria Police revealed in a statement that "an elderly man was in critical condition" after being rushed to hospital.
And on Tuesday, police confirmed that four men aged 30, 25, 23, and 18 were arrested on suspicion of causing serious injury by dangerous driving. A spokesman for Northumbria Police said in a statement: "The victim remains in a critical but stable condition in hospital. "Officers are continuing to carry out a range of inquiries into the incident." The oldest of the men, 30, remains in custody as police continue their investigation into the incident.The arrest of the four men came after eyewitnesses claimed they saw a group of four men return to the scene to pick up debris from the road.The day earlier, Chelsea shared an emotional post as she begged anyone in contact with the driver or who knows who was in the vehicle to "do the right thing".
"There are four lads who all have mams, dads, aunties, uncles, and friends so there are a lot of people in a very small area that have information on what happened last night," she said. "Do the right thing. You have left somebody in a critical condition.
